: Thwarted by the strike, Zazie runs wild through Paris, encountering a surreal cast of characters including a cross-dressing uncle, a possibly predatory policeman, and various eccentric locals. Literary Style: "Néo-Français"
The 1959 novel by Raymond Queneau was a radical experiment in language.
: Zazie, a precocious and foul-mouthed 10-year-old from the provinces, travels to Paris to spend a weekend with her Uncle Gabriel.
: Her only goal is to ride the famous Paris Métro, but her visit coincides with a city-wide transit strike.
